“I Read Canadian” is being celebrated at HPEDSB schools

I Read Canadian

February 18, 2020-Tomorrow, February 19, 2020, is I Read Canadian Day and several HPEDSB schools are participating.

I Read Canadian Day is a national day of celebration of Canadian books for young people. This is a day dedicated to reading Canadian and encourages schools, libraries and organizations to host local activities and events within the week.

HPEDSB schools are hosting author visits and putting Canadian books on display in libraries. All are challenged to read Canadian for 15 minutes.
